Q2: What’s the difference between 2.4GHz and 5GHz WiFi, and why does it matter for my camera?
Most home WiFi security cameras, especially pan/tilt models, connect to the 2.4GHz WiFi band. This band offers a wider range and better penetration through walls than 5GHz, which is great for cameras placed further from your router. However, 2.4GHz is generally slower than 5GHz and can be more susceptible to interference. Always check which band your camera supports and ensure your router is broadcasting on that frequency.

Q4: How much storage do I need for my pet camera footage?
This depends on how much you want to record and how long you want to keep it. Most cameras offer local storage via a microSD card (ranging from 128GB to 512GB) or cloud storage plans. For continuous 24/7 recording, a larger microSD card (like 256GB or 512GB) is ideal. Cloud storage offers convenience and off-site backup, but often comes with a monthly fee. Consider your budget and how critical it is to retain long periods of footage.

Q6: What about privacy concerns with indoor cameras?
Privacy is a valid concern. To maximize your security, ensure your camera uses strong encryption (like WPA2/WPA3 for WiFi) and that you create a strong, unique password for your camera’s app and account. Place cameras thoughtfully, avoiding private areas if you have roommates or frequent guests. Most reputable brands also use encrypted cloud storage to protect your footage.
